Over 185,000 illegal immigrant arrests were made at the U.S.–Mexico border in August, according to provisional U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) statistics obtained by The Epoch Times.
Some 186,424 apprehensions were made by border agents during the month.
Most arrests—about 53,400—took place in the Del Rio Sector an area of 55,063 square miles in Texas, including 245 miles along the Rio Grande River and Lake Amistad at the border.
The arrests are down slightly from August 2021, when CBP agents made 196,514 arrests. They’re up significantly from August 2020, when under 48,000 arrests were recorded, and August 2019, when just 50,684 arrests were made.
Apprehensions made by the Office of Field Operations, another subagency within the Department of Homeland Security, are not included in the provisional count. The subagency has made an average of approximately 13,000 arrests per month at the southern border over the past 10 months….
